Introduction

The University of Georgia, founded in 1785 in Athens, is a flagship public research university offering a comprehensive range of undergraduate, graduate, and professional programs. With a large and diverse student body, UGA combines historic campus character with extensive academic resources across arts and sciences, business, education, agriculture, public health, and more. The university is noted for research productivity, strong faculty mentorship, and a wide array of extracurricular and leadership opportunities.

UGA provides abundant research centers, laboratories, and experiential learning programs that connect students to faculty projects and industry partners. The institution supports international collaboration and maintains services for global students, including advising, language resources, and career preparation. Athletics, arts, and an active student life in Athens create a vibrant cultural setting that complements rigorous academics and professional development.

About the Program

The Master in Biochemical Engineering, MS is a master's degree for students who want to study biochemical engineering. It is taught in English and takes a few years to complete. The main advantage is that you get to study at the University of Georgia, Athens, which is a well-known university.

This program teaches you about biochemical engineering principles and how to apply them in practice. You will learn about subjects like biochemistry, molecular biology, and chemical engineering. You will also develop skills like lab work, data analysis, and problem-solving. The program includes hands-on components like research projects and lab experiments.

After graduating, you can work as a Biochemical Engineer, Research Scientist, Process Engineer, or Quality Control Specialist. You can find jobs in pharmaceutical companies, biotech firms, or food processing industries. The skills you learn in this program can help you get a good job in these fields.
